2024 Nissan Murano FWD
Fuel Economy Overview
The 2024 Nissan Murano FWD achieves an EPA-estimated 23 MPG in combined city and highway driving, with 20 MPG in the city and 28 MPG on the highway. Powered by a 3.5L 6-cylinder engine paired with a automatic (av-s7), this midsize station wagons features Front-Wheel Drive drive.
In terms of environmental impact, the 2024 Murano FWD produces approximately 388 grams of CO2 per mile. This figure is measured under standardized EPA test conditions and represents tailpipe emissions only. For context, the average new vehicle sold in the United States produces approximately 400 grams of CO2 per mile, meaning this Murano FWD performs better than the national average in this regard.
The estimated annual fuel cost for this vehicle is $2,600, based on 15,000 miles of driving per year and current national average fuel prices. Compared to the average new vehicle, you would save $2,250 over a 5-year period. This calculation accounts for differences in fuel consumption efficiency and provides a practical measure of long-term ownership costs attributable to fuel economy.

Aerodynamic Speed Penalty
EPA highway tests average roughly 48 mph. Driving at 75 mph increases aerodynamic drag exponentially. Expect your real-world highway fuel economy to drop by roughly 15-20% at interstate speeds.

Recall Intelligence
Nissan North America, Inc. (Nissan) is recalling certain 2024 Murano vehicles. The incorrect primer may have been used on the quarter glass, resulting in the left and right quarter glass detaching from the vehicle.
Consequence & Remedy
Consequence: Detached glass panels can become a road hazard,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Dealers will replace both side quarter glass panels,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 7, 2024. Owners may contact Nissan customer service at 1-800-867-7669. Nissan's number for this recall is PD102.
